Since 2006, the Montluçon French Song Festival has celebrated the richness and diversity of French-language music every summer. Organized by the City of Montluçon, this free event has become an essential fixture on the French music scene over more than twenty editions.
The festival takes place in an exceptional setting: the medieval city of Montluçon, dominated by the majestic Château des ducs de Bourbon built in 1370. The Esplanade du Château, offering a striking panorama of the city and the loops of the Cher river, is the festival's main stage. The banks of the Cher also host concerts, creating a unique atmosphere between historical heritage and contemporary musical creation.
Each edition offers about fifteen completely free concerts spread over three days. The main program features established French artists—text-based songs, French pop, folk, slam—as well as musical tributes to great figures of French song. In parallel, the "Off" program features five stages in five emblematic locations in the medieval city, providing a showcase for emerging artists and local talents.
The festival emphasizes the discovery of new talents and offers platforms that allow winners to benefit from studio recordings and opening slots at subsequent editions.
The complete freeness of the festival is at the heart of its philosophy: making culture accessible to all, without economic barriers. Every year, thousands of spectators gather in the cobbled streets of old Montluçon to share moments of conviviality around music. The festival contributes to the cultural influence of Montluçon and the enhancement of its exceptional medieval heritage, classified among the most remarkable in the Auvergne-Rhône-Alpes region.
Over the years, the French Song Festival has hosted renowned artists and revealed many talents, establishing itself as a major French song event in the center of France.

The Montluçon French Song Festival returns for its 21st edition from August 14 to 16, 2026. On the third weekend of August, the medieval city will once again vibrate to the rhythm of French-language song with a completely free program.
The main stage will be set up on the Esplanade du Château des ducs de Bourbon, while the "Off" program will take over five locations in old Montluçon. The full program will be announced during the summer of 2026.

By car: Montluçon is accessible via the A71 motorway from Paris or Clermont-Ferrand. The Esplanade du Château is located in the medieval city, at the top of the town. Parking is available near the city center.
By train: Montluçon-Ville station is served from Paris-Austerlitz (via Vierzon) and Clermont-Ferrand. The medieval city is about a 15-minute walk from the station.
